Developing an expert-knowledge scoring system for evaluating reductive dechlorination at TCE sites

摘要

Decision-making approaches that are not only transparent but also science- and case-based are in high demand in the hazardous waste industry. The present work focuses on developing an explicit methodology to allow translation of expert knowledge about any complex process involved in a remedial decision into an easy-to-use decision tool. The methodology is applied to evaluate reductive dechlorination as a remedial possibility at sites contaminated with trichloroethene (TCE), building on an existing protocol/scoring system put forth by the US Air Force and the US EPA. This paper presents the development of an alternate scoring system, which has two major advantages, namely that it (ⅰ) attributes relative weights to findings based on expert beliefs and (ⅱ) systematically includes negative weights for negative findings.
